Output 8075ee7faf521a0e6fa61db369e4b786672396307695018ec21a616c26e0854c:5

value
135894
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 84182cbbe8f70b8606ff0fbaa4ac9bfd20efb662a50f74d535b849d6d4b3105c
address
bc1pssvzewlg7u9cvphlp7a2ftyml5swldnz558hf4f4hpyad49nzpwq5me3ee
transaction
8075ee7faf521a0e6fa61db369e4b786672396307695018ec21a616c26e0854c
spent
true